Understanding RNG and Why It Matters
An RNG is a computer algorithm that produces unpredictable results for each spin, hand, or roll. Casinos that use certified RNGs must prove that every outcome is independent and unbiased.
Key characteristics of a trustworthy RNG:
- Unpredictability: No pattern can be detected, even by advanced analysis.
- Uniform distribution: Every possible result has an equal chance of occurring.
- Auditable code: Independent auditors can review the source code and test logs.
When an RNG fails, players may see streaks that feel “rigged.” That erodes trust and can lead to regulatory penalties.
Example
Imagine a slot with a 96% RTP. Over 10,000 spins, a fair RNG will return roughly $9,600 for every $10,000 wagered. If the algorithm were biased, the return could drop dramatically, and players would notice the difference quickly.
